LanXi387 / game-Toolbox

一个简洁的游戏网址工具箱
GNU General Public License v3.0
2 stars 2 forks source link

How to use GitHub guides #1

Open Muska-Ami opened 3 months ago

Muska-Ami commented 3 months ago

本 Issue 不是一个问题报告,但我认为有必要。本 Issue 能帮助您更好的使用 GitHub 。 这不是一个官方发送的 Issue ,而是本人自愿编写。

关于代码文件

我们来观察一下你的代码文件和提交消息: image

可以看到,你的代码提交全部是手动通过 GitHub Add file via upload 或者在线编辑功能上传的。事实上,我认为 GitHub 的 Web 编辑并不符合这个平台代码提交的初衷,只是为了方便临时的修改。

正确的做法是通过 Git 这样的 版本控制系统(VCS) 来提交代码,并推送到仓库。

并且,你是否发现,你的文件列表出现了这样的情况: image

事实上,这样做是 完全错误 的。

顾名思义,这个平台叫做 GitHub ,那么它就是使用 Git 来实现 版本管理 功能的。 所以,你的每一个 提交(commit) 都会被记录,并可以被查询。比如: image

这样,就可以查询到你在 f0c579c(f0c579c23323cddab98dc3661f9f0f888ce7f67b) 这个 commit 时的代码,也就是你不需要每个版本都上传,只需要更新一个文件,这样不仅是符合规范的,同时也便于查询代码更改,比如前面的 f0c579c23323cddab98dc3661f9f0f888ce7f67b ,点进去就可以看到 差异(diff) 信息。

关于语法

我发现你的 Release 里面的更新信息,使用了如下的格式:

+第一个更新
+第二个更新

事实上,你可以使用 Markdown 列表:

<!-- 无序列表 -->
- 第一个更新
- 第二个更新

<!-- 有序列表 -->
1. 第一个更新
2. 第二个更新

记住,在大多数代码共享平台,你都可以使用类似的 Markdown 语法。

关于 Markdown 语法指南,请查阅 GitHub Markdown。这里列出了 GitHub 支持的 Markdown 语法。

关于其他的不一一赘述,如果你想用好这个平台,请熟读 GitHub Docs

ltzXiaoYanMo commented 3 months ago

🤔

daizihan233 commented 3 months ago

🤓